Zauba

SKN%20INVESTMENTS%20(CHENNAI)%20PRIVATE%20LIMITEDCIN: U67190DL2008PTC183199
new.inc
SKN INVESTMENTS (CHENNAI) PRIVATE LIMITED | Zauba